IPL 2026: Suryakumar Yadav Hits 51 As MI Post 162/6 Against DC On A Slow Pitch
Indian Premier League: Stand-in captain Suryakumar Yadav top-scored with 51 as the Mumbai Indians posted a competitive 162/6 in 20 overs on a slow black-soil pitch against the Delhi Capitals at the Arun Jaitley Stadium in New Delhi on Saturday.
It was the kind of innings for MI that never quite found its stride – Suryakumar and Rohit Sharma steadied proceedings with a 53-run stand. But just as it threatened to build into something decisive, DC intervened to pick wickets at regular intervals, with Mukesh Kumar being the standout bowler with 2-26.
Suryakumar's measured 51 off 36 balls, laced with three fours and two sixes, was the spine of MI’s innings and took them past the 160-mark, despite 38 runs coming from the final four overs. The crowd found its voice early on when Ryan Rickelton flicked Mukesh Kumar through midwicket and fine leg for fours, while fan favourite Rohit Sharma picked two boundaries off Lungi Ngidi through point and fine leg regions.
